Mastering the basics of movement mechanics in CS2 is crucial for any aspiring player. Understanding how to move effectively can mean the difference between victory and defeat. Players must focus on three fundamental aspects: walking, running, and crouching. Each movement type has its own advantages and disadvantages, impacting your ability to aim and evade enemy fire. For instance, walking allows for more accurate shooting due to a slower pace, while running is essential for positioning and quick escapes. To fully grasp these mechanics, practice is key, and familiarizing yourself with different maps will help you understand when to apply each movement technique.
An advanced understanding of CS2 movement mechanics also involves mastering techniques like strafing and counter-strafing. Strafing helps players move laterally while maintaining a target in sight, creating a challenging dynamic for opponents. By alternating the direction of your movement, you can dodge bullets and remain unpredictable. Counter-strafing, on the other hand, allows for a quick stop followed by rapid firing, ensuring your shots land accurately. Players should also pay attention to the game's mechanics that affect movement speed, such as weapon type and player stances. Understanding these nuances will give you an edge in competitive gameplay, making movement mechanics a cornerstone of your CS2 strategy.

Improving your movement skills in CS2 can have a significant impact on your overall gameplay. One of the key aspects to focus on is mastering the strafing technique, which allows you to move side to side while maintaining accuracy. A simple way to practice this is by entering a local match or a practice map, such as aim_map, where you can hone your skills without the pressure of a live game. Start by alternating your movement keys (A and D) while trying to aim at a stationary target. This not only improves your agility but also helps to develop muscle memory.
Another vital tip is to utilize the jump and crouch mechanics effectively. Combining these two with your movement can enhance your evasiveness during engagements. For instance, while jumping, strafe to one side to throw off your opponent's aim. Practicing bhopping (bunny hopping) can also help you traverse maps faster and make you a harder target to hit. To successfully execute bhops, remember to adjust your mouse movement to align with your jump direction while timing your key presses accurately. In summary, focusing on dynamic movements and practicing regularly can significantly enhance your movement skills in CS2.
Advanced movement techniques in CS2 have revolutionized the way players approach gameplay, providing them with a competitive edge. Techniques such as bhop (bunny hopping) and strafing allow players to navigate the map swiftly, evade enemy fire, and position themselves advantageously. By mastering these techniques, players not only enhance their speed and agility but also improve their overall game sense, which is crucial in high-stakes situations. For instance, a player who can effectively utilize these movements is more likely to dodge bullets and confuse opponents, leading to a higher chance of survival and successful engagements.
Moreover, incorporating advanced movement strategies contributes significantly to CS2 gameplay by allowing for better map control and zone dominance. Techniques like wall strafes and crouch jumps enable players to reach unconventional spots and execute surprise attacks. These movements necessitate precise timing and control, which can be practiced extensively to gain an advantage over adversaries. In summary, mastering advanced movement techniques not only enhances individual player performance but also contributes to team dynamics, as it opens up more tactical options during matches.
